The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 98535 zip code. The total population is 598, of which, 359 are male and 239 are female. With a total area of 26.469 square miles, the population density is 28.6 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 51.5 years old. Education
In the 98535 zip code, 76.6%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 9.5%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 98535 zip, there are an estimated 341 people in the labor force, of which, 291 are employed, and 50 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ces.
